Electric versus Gas Golf Carts: Advantages and Tradeoffs

When evaluating electric and gas golf carts, several factors come into play, including performance, energy type, and maintenance costs. Each type provides distinct benefits and drawbacks that can shape a customer's choice. Additionally, environmental impact considerations further complicate the choice between these two options.

Performance and Power Source

Choosing between gas and electric golf carts calls for evaluating multiple performance factors and power sources. Electric carts are known for their quiet operation and instant torque, establishing them as perfect for short trips on the course. They often present a smoother ride and involve less maintenance, thanks to fewer moving parts. However, their range can be limited, calling for regular charging.

By contrast, gas carts provide greater power and speed, often excelling on hilly terrains. They can sustain operation longer without adding fuel and are more ideal for comprehensive golf courses. Nonetheless, gas carts are often quite noisy and expel fumes, which may undermine the golfing experience. Ultimately, the choice comes down to individual preferences regarding performance and environmental considerations.

Maintenance and Operating Costs

Costs for maintenance and operation vary notably between electric and gas golf carts, influencing overall ownership expenses. Electric carts tend to have reduced operating costs thanks to fewer moving parts, which results in less maintenance. Battery replacements, however, can be expensive and usually happen every five to seven years. Gas carts, by comparison, require regular oil changes, air filter replacements, and fuel, all of which can add up over time. Although gas carts often provide a longer range and faster refueling, their maintenance can be more intensive. Ultimately, prospective owners need to weigh these costs carefully to find the option that best fits with their budget and usage needs, ensuring a well-informed decision for enjoyable time on the course.

Excellent Maintenance Tips for Extending Your Golf Cart's Lifespan

Consistent maintenance is essential for maximizing the lifespan of a golf cart. Regular service tasks consist of monitoring and preserving tire pressure to guarantee optimal functionality and safety. Regularly inspecting the battery and cleaning terminals can avoid oxidation and improve performance. It's crucial to examine the brake system, replacing worn components as required to preserve security on the course. In plus, regular oil replacements and filter replacements are necessary to keep the engine running smoothly. Keeping the vehicle clean, both inside and out, shields the outside and prevents rust. Furthermore, keeping the vehicle in a dry, shaded area will protect it from severe weather. Finally, reviewing the instruction guide for detailed care instructions can assist owners follow manufacturer recommendations, ensuring longevity. By implementing these maintenance tips, cart proprietors can experience dependable operation for years to come.

Common Questions Frequently Asked

What Establishes the Median Expense of Renting a Golf Cart?

A golf cart rental typically costs between $30 to $50 per round on a standard basis. Various factors including location, duration, and rental service can influence pricing, making it important to compare options before leasing.

How Prolonged Am I Permitted to rent a Golf Cart?

Customarily, golf carts may be rented for different durations, stretching from a few hours up to a full day. Certain services offer weekly rates, meeting varied needs based on user preferences and course requirements.

What Age Constraints Apply Leasing Golf Carts?

Most golf cart rental companies enforce age restrictions, generally mandating renters to be at least 18 or 21 years old. Some may allow younger drivers with a valid copyright and parental consent.

May I Use a Golf Cart on Public Roads?

Golf carts may be used on public roads in certain areas, as long as they follow local regulations. Typically, these regulations include age restrictions, speed limits, and designated lanes to ensure safety for all users.
